What is a Director of Talent Acquisition?
A Director of Talent Acquisition leads the recruitment and hiring strategies for an organization. They are responsible for developing and implementing talent acquisition plans, managing the recruitment process, and ensuring that the organization attracts and hires the best possible candidates.
Responsibilities of a Director of Talent Acquisition
The responsibilities of a Director of Talent Acquisition typically include:
- Developing and implementing talent acquisition strategies
- Managing the recruitment process
- Screening and interviewing candidates
- Negotiating salaries and benefits packages
- Onboarding new hires
- Managing the talent acquisition team
- Staying up-to-date on the latest recruitment trends
Skills and Qualifications for a Director of Talent Acquisition
To become a Director of Talent Acquisition, you typically need a bachelor's degree in human resources, business, or a related field. You also need several years of experience in recruitment and hiring. Additionally, you should have strong leadership skills, as well as strong communication and interpersonal skills.
